THE TIMES’ RANKINGS

Share

Through Saturday’s games

Rk Team

(Rec., Div.) Comment (last ranking)

1 VILLA PARK

(9-1, SS-Div. II) Has given up one run or less in five of last six games. (5)

*

2 VALENCIA

(8-3, SS-Div. II) Hart lost bid for upset by committing four errors in fifth. (6)

*

3 ANAHEIM CANYON

(9-4, SS-Div. II) Few can solve Villa Park’s Mark Trumbo in 4-0 loss. (3)

*

4 CHATSWORTH

(13-0, City) Plenty of gaming this week at the Las Vegas Durango tournament. (4)

*

5 LAKEWOOD

(9-4, SS-Div. I) Gave up two runs in last six games, 10 walks all season. (10)

*

6 MARINA

(10-2, SS-Div. I) Two games back after first round of league play, but nobody’s pacing. (1)

*

7 CRESPI

(11-2, SS-Div. III) Blanked in consecutive games before edging Chaminade in rematch. (2)

*

8 FOOTHILL

(10-2, SS-Div. II) Has not allowed more than one run in six of last seven games. (8)

*

9 SANTA MARGARITA

(7-5, SS-Div. I) Finished on other end of pitchers’ dual vs. Bishop Amat’s Steve Martlaro. (7)

*

10 MATER DEI

(9-4, SS-Div. I) Finally gets a home game and defeats St. John Bosco, 7-2. (9)

*

11 THOUSAND OAKS

(10-2, SS-Div. II) Won five consecutive Marmonte League games, all by three runs or less. (18)

*

12 WESTM. LA QUINTA

(12-0-1, SS-Div. IV) Brandon Laird, Alex Jorgenson strike out 20 in sweep of Alhambra. (13)

*

13 MISSION VIEJO

(9-4, SS-Div. I) Combined to outscore Trabuco Hills and El Toro (twice), 28-4. (14)

*

14 SERVITE

(9-4, SS-Div. I) Kyle Brown does not allow earned run in 8-2 win over Bishop Amat. (16)

*

15 CANYON SPRINGS

(11-2, SS-Div. I) Joe Spiers homers in final at-bat to set state record for hitting streak. (20)

*

16 SAN CLEMENTE

(11-3, SS-Div. I) Can’t do any better than a split vs. Trabuco Hills. (15)

*

17 HUNTINGTON BEACH

(8-4, SS-Div. I) Has quietly built a two-game lead after first round of Sunset League play. (NR)

*

18 MOORPARK

(9-4, SS-Div. II) Still having trouble producing runs, but staff isn’t allowing many. (NR)

*

19 AGOURA

(9-4, SS-Div. II) Has outscored opponents, 7-3, during current three-game win streak. (NR)

*

20 CAPISTRANO VALLEY

(9-4-1, SS-Div. I) Would rather rewind clocks a week to erase losses to El Toro, Dana Hills. (11)

*

21 EL CAMINO REAL

(6-5, City) After three consecutive losses, took a couple breathers last week vs. Taft. (21)

*

22 ARLINGTON

(8-5, SS-Div. I) Lucas Duda’s sixth-inning grand slam breaks tie vs. Moreno Valley. (22)

*

23 CORONA

(10-2, SS-Div. II) Panthers hit bump in the road in 10-4 loss to Corona Santiago. (17)

*

24 ROYAL

(6-3, SS-Div. II) Bounced Simi Valley from top 25 with third straight league setback. (19)

*

25 LA MIRADA

(10-2, SS-Div. III) Breaks into rankings with eight-game winning streak. (NR)
